Browsing by Course-Related Materials or Libraries and Collections : located in OER Teaching and Learning Materials . You can also browse by subject areas as well as grade level.

Under the heading“Course-Related Materials,”there are three categories:

  • Full Course—to see all or part of a course
  • Learning Modules—to see a portion of a course
  • OpenCourseWare—to see all materials in MIT’s OCW Consortium.

At a glance, you can see how many items are in each category. The number in parentheses shows the quantity of OER items for that category. If, for example, you don’t have time to browse hundreds or thousands of OER items, filter your search after you click on the category.

If you are looking for a specific instructional component such as a simulation or a video lecture, course-related materials are also categorized by 16 different instructional components. Clicking on any one of these components will display a listing of all the items for that particular instructional component.

Under the heading“Libraries and Collections,”you will find digitized primary sources from a wide variety of digital media collections and libraries.

You can also browse each individual content provider’s collection for either the Course-Related Materials or the Libraries and Collections.

Browsing by Tags

Tags are keywords you associate with an OER item. Tags are a way for you to personalize/categorize OER items. OER Commons provides pre-set categories; tags are the way for you to create your own categories. Read more on tags .

Top 30 Tags : located on the right side of the OER Commons homepage.

The results page lists other tags related to the one you chose.

TagCloud: located on the right side of the OER Commons homepage . The“ TagCloud ”page lists all the tags in OER Commons.

The size of a word indicates its popularity.

Activity: find materials

Using one or more of the searching or browsing methods, locate materials you can begin using in your teaching or learning. After finding an item you can use, save it by clicking the“Save Item”link located under the title. (See Figure 3.)

Figure 3. Visual representation of an OER item with the“Save Item”link.

When you save this item, it goes into your portfolio. We’ll be talking more about your OER Portfolio in another module.
